My wife runs a relatively small business (TO below 200k pa) and has been caught up in the Barclays business bank account mess that was in the press this weekend. Poor comms from Barclays, account has been closed by Barclays, lots of calls to useless customer service. Nobody in the local branch can help because they don't do business banking, and despite filling out an online application for a new business account 2 weeks ago, absolutely nothing from Barclays.
In the meantime suppliers not getting paid, and she is receiving no income from customers. And she can't deposit the cheque Barclays sent her for funds in closed account as it's made out to the business that currently has no bank account!
What's the best bank for small business banking with good customer service? There are no borrowing requirements, cashflow is normally not an issue so do understand why it's not the most attractive thing for a bank to get involved in. But someone must be interested in the smaller businesses?

Monzo are ranked at the top of the league tables for business banks:
https://www.bva-bdrc.com/products/business-banking...
Having had loads of hassle and being ignored by Barclays myself for 3 weeks, I switched recently - literally 5 minutes to sign up on the app and have the account open.
Paying in cheques is by post though, and can take a few weeks. I very rarely have them, so it isn't an issue for me.

I use Starling and rate them very highly. Monzo didn’t do business accounts when I opened the Starling one (changed from TSB, awful!) but if Monzo business accounts had been around then, o would have probably got one, I have a couple of Monzo personal accounts and also rate them Highly. Our great thing bout starling, which may be the same with Monzo is that you can do everything related to invoicing and Vat/tax returns on the website, if you subscribe to the business toolkit.
